Top Five Players To Watch In NFL Week One Stuck
Posted on September 4, 2012 at 04:09 PM.


Football is here! Football is here! Well, the meaningful games are here -- thankfully.

College Football started up this past weekend, and as a Maryland fan, I’m ready for the NFL to begin and have been waiting for this all summer.

With that in mind, here are the five players I'm keeping my eye on in the first week of the season.

Quarterback Drew Brees, New Orleans Saints

Brees is starting his first game without head coach Sean Payton and will be missing Joe Vitt as well. It will be interesting to see how the Saints offense performs without their coaches. Brees should still be a solid player, and against the Redskins secondary with two below-average Safties, should have a huge game. But will they show any side effects of not having the coaches around that built this offense.

Quarterbacks Robert Griffin III, Washington Redskins and Andrew Luck, Indianapolis Colts

Of course they are here. They have to be. The top two draft picks of this year will be starring in their first regular-season games of their young careers. How will Andrew Luck handle that Bears front seven? Will Robert Griffin III be intimated by the fans in the Superdome? Luck is farther ahead at this point than Robert Griffin III, but will the two show jitters in their first start? I wouldn’t count on it. I’d expect both to show well in their first start.

Wide Receivers Malcom Floyd and Robert Meachem, San Diego Chargers

Meachem will be counted on to replace the void that Vincent Jackson left when he left for greener pastures in Tampa Bay. Floyd is expected to take a step-up in production as well. The two will have the enigmatic Philip Rivers tossing them the ball. Will both of them be able to step up and help Rivers return to elite status? Oakland's secondary can be torched, and Rivers has the arm to do it. I'm assuming one of these guys steps up and becomes the number one guy, which one -- I'm still not sure yet.

Quarterback Russell Wilson, Seattle Seahawks

Floyd and Meachem I'm just going to count as one person, so here's a bonus in Wilson. Was his preseason the real deal or was it a fluke? We'll find out Sunday against the Cardinals.
